首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何正确使用Vue.set()?

Vue.set() 是 Vue.js 提供的一个全局方法,用于在响应式对象中添加新的响应式属性。它的使用方式如下:

代码语言:txt
复制
Vue.set(object, key, value)

参数解释:

  • object: 必选参数,要添加属性的对象。
  • key: 必选参数,要添加的属性名。
  • value: 必选参数,要添加的属性值。

Vue.set() 的作用是向响应式对象中添加一个新的响应式属性。这样做的好处是,当新属性被添加时,Vue 将能够监听到该属性的变化,并立即更新视图。

Vue.set() 的使用场景通常是在开发过程中需要在对象中动态添加属性的情况,特别是在使用 Vue.js 的响应式系统时。例如,在处理动态表单的情况下,当用户添加新的表单项时,可以使用 Vue.set() 来添加新的属性,从而确保新的表单项能够响应式地更新。

下面是一个示例代码:

代码语言:txt
复制
// 在 Vue 组件中使用 Vue.set()
export default {
  data() {
    return {
      items: []
    }
  },
  methods: {
    addItem() {
      const newItem = {
        name: 'New Item',
        price: 10
      }
      Vue.set(this.items, this.items.length, newItem)
    }
  }
}

在上述示例代码中,我们定义了一个名为 items 的响应式数组,通过 addItem() 方法向 items 数组中添加新的对象。使用 Vue.set() 方法,我们可以在数组的指定索引位置添加一个新的响应式对象。

关于腾讯云的相关产品和产品介绍链接地址,由于题目要求不提及具体的云计算品牌商,因此无法提供具体的腾讯云产品信息。你可以参考腾讯云官方文档,了解他们提供的与Vue相关的云服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

5分9秒

如何正确使用技术词汇

22K
-

如何让元宇宙走上正确的道路,仍需加以正确的引导。#元宇宙

1分1秒

UserAgent如何使用

1分26秒

事件代理如何使用?

1分24秒

如何使用OneCode开源版本?

55秒

如何使用appuploader描述文件

1分34秒

如何使用 CS 定义代码环境

5分10秒

033-如何使用FLUX文档

1分18秒

如何使用`open-uri`模块

1时22分

Android核心技术:一节课教你 Get 5G时代使用Webview的正确姿势!

34分5秒

javaweb项目实战 19使用AJAX异步验证用户唯一和验证码是否正确 学习猿地

2分55秒

动物实验中小分子化合物的溶解操作, 不同比例的助溶剂如何正确添加?手把手教学视频来啦~

领券